Job summary

Wing is seeking a Flight Operations Support Coordinator to join the Flight Operations team in multiple U.S. sites including St. Louis, Memphis, Cincinnati, or Phoenix.

This 36-month fixed-term contract supports ground scheduling, onboarding of vendor staff, and crew readiness across Wing operating sites. The role requires drone operation experience, 14 CFR Part 107 certification, and strong collaboration within small teams in safety-sensitive environments.

Qualifications

  • 3+ years scheduling teams of 10+
  • 1+ year operational drone experience in the US
  • 1+ year field technician experience
  • Valid driver's license with clean record
  • Active 14 CFR Part 107 Remote Pilot Certificate
  • Demonstrated ability to communicate constructively under stress
  • Experience with Deputy or ServiceNow
  • Proficiency with Google Workspace (G Suite)

Responsibilities

  • Report to Senior Flight Operations Support Manager or Regional Site Lead.
  • Develop Ground Support and Visual Observer crew schedules for approval.
  • Obtain compliance records for vendor staff.
  • Identify training requirements and schedule trainings with Wing teams.
  • Support maintenance activities at nests or central facility.
  • Move Wing equipment between locations up to 60 miles per day.
  • Maintain qualifications as Ground Support Operator and Visual Observer.
  • Coordinate equipment replacement with Regional Lead.
  • Assist with Wing community affairs and government outreach.
